166 | Print "HDF5SaveGroup failed" |
---|
167 | result = -1 |
---|
168 | endif |
---|
169 | |
---|
170 | HDF5CloseFile fileID |
---|
171 | |
---|
172 | return result |
---|
173 | End |
---|
174 | |
---|
175 | |
---|
176 | // |
---|
177 | // writes out the contents of a data folder using the gateway |
---|
178 | // -- the HDF5___xref wave must be present at the toep level for it to |
---|
179 | // write out anything. |
---|
180 | // |
---|
181 | Proc H_HDF5Gate_Write_Raw(dfPath, filename) |
---|
182 | String dfPath ="root:VSANS_file" // e.g., "root:FolderA" or ":" |
---|
183 | String filename = "Test_VSANS_file.h5" |
---|
184 | |
---|

330 | |
---|
331 | // |
---|
332 | // Writing attributes to a group and to a dataset. |
---|
333 | // example from the WM documentation for HDF5SaveData |
---|
334 | // |
---|
335 | Function DemoAttributes(w) |
---|
336 | Wave w |
---|
337 | |
---|
338 | Variable result = 0 // 0 means no error |
---|
339 | |
---|
340 | // Create file |
---|
341 | Variable fileID |
---|
342 | HDF5CreateFile/P=home /O /Z fileID as "Test.h5" |
---|
343 | if (V_flag != 0) |
---|
344 | Print "HDF5CreateFile failed" |
---|
345 | return -1 |
---|
346 | endif |
---|
347 | |
---|
348 | // Write an attribute to the root group |
---|
349 | Make /FREE /T /N=1 groupAttribute = "This is a group attribute" |
---|
350 | HDF5SaveData /A="GroupAttribute" groupAttribute, fileID, "/" |
---|
351 | |
---|
352 | // Save wave as dataset |
---|
353 | HDF5SaveData /O /Z w, fileID // Uses wave name as dataset name |
---|
354 | if (V_flag != 0) |
---|
355 | Print "HDF5SaveData failed" |
---|
356 | result = -1 |
---|
357 | endif |
---|
358 | |
---|
359 | // Write an attribute to the dataset |
---|
360 | Make /FREE /T /N=1 datasetAttribute = "This is a dataset attribute" |
---|
361 | String datasetName = NameOfWave(w) |
---|
362 | HDF5SaveData /A="DatasetAttribute" datasetAttribute, fileID, datasetName |
---|
363 | |
---|
364 | HDF5CloseFile fileID |
---|
365 | |
---|
366 | return result |
---|
367 | End // The attribute waves are automatically killed since they are free waves |
---|
